Overview

The BYD Battery-Box Premium LVS is a modular 48V lithium iron phosphate (LFP) battery pack for use with an external inverter. Between 1 and 6 battery modules can be used in a single stack to give 4.0 to 24.0 kWh usable capacity. Alternatively, up to 16 Battery-Box LVS stacks consisting of between 1 and 4 battery modules can be connected in parallel to give a maximum capacity of 256 kWh. Additional LVS modules or parallel stacks can be added at any time to increase capacity, 1 PDU base and cover is required for each battery stack and 1 BMU p er system/inverter. Scalable from 4 kWh to 256 kWh Maximum flexibility for any application with up to 64 modules connected in parallel Compatible with market leading 1 and 3 Phase Inverters Cobalt Free Lithium Iron Phosphate (LFP) Battery: Maximum Safety, life cycle and power Capable of High-Powered Emergency-Backup and Off-Grid Function Patented Internal Plug Design Requires No Additional Wiring Self-Consumption Optimization for Residential and Commercial Applications Maximum current at different temperatures Temperature Maxium charge current Maximum discharge current Remarks -10℃≤T<0℃ 48A 48A *N of the modules 0℃≤T<5℃ 48A 65A *N of the modules 5℃≤T<50℃ 65A 65A *N of the modules, up to 250A per tower Note: Commissioning the battery requires a device capable of running the BYD Be Connect App - available for the Apple App Store and Google Play Store. Excludes: Cat5 cable for communication between BMU and parallel stacks, 1x required per stack/PDU.

Before you buy a battery

The checks below apply to any battery. Run them against the specification table above — most disappointing solar purchases are compatible-on-paper units that fail one of these in practice.

  • Match voltage to the inverter, and confirm the battery appears on the inverter maker's supported list. Closed-loop communication lets the inverter respect the battery's real charge limits instead of guessing.
  • Read the warranty in full: lithium warranties are stated as a term plus either a cycle count or a total energy throughput, and whichever limit arrives first ends the cover.
  • Leave room to expand. Packs that parallel cleanly let you add capacity later; ones that do not force a full replacement.
  • Compare usable kilowatt-hours, not nameplate capacity. A 100 Ah lead-acid battery at 12 V is nominally 1.2 kWh but only about 0.6 kWh is safely usable, while a 100 Ah LiFePO4 pack gives you roughly 1.0–1.2 kWh.

Where buyers lose money

  • Installing lithium packs in an unventilated, hot enclosure. Sustained high temperature is the fastest way to lose cycle life.
  • Ignoring the charge current limit and pairing a large array with a small bank, which trips protection and shortens life.
  • Mixing old and new batteries, or different chemistries, in one bank. The weakest unit drags the whole bank down and can be damaged by the others.
